Preparation and electrical properties of (LaO)AgS and (LnO)CuS (Ln = La,Pr, or Nd)

Description
This paper reports on a layered compound (LaO)AgS, obtained from La2O2S and Cu2S in vacuo at 853-1373 K. The ac, ionic, and electronic conductivities and the thermoelectromotive forces of the products were measured under a purified helium gas atmosphere at 300-573 K and at 77.4-700 K, respectively. The compound (LaO)AgS was an n-type mixed ionic conductor, whereas (LaO)CuS and (PrO)CuS were an electronic p-type semiconductor. A conduction mechanism was proposed for (LaO)AgS and (LaO)CuS
